Professional Applications & Engineering Value
These alloy steel flat head screws deliver critical performance in heavy machinery, structural assemblies, and precision equipment where vibration resistance and high tensile strength are paramount. The UNF fine threading with Class 3A fit ensures superior thread engagement in tapped holes, reducing loosening under dynamic loads. The 82° countersink angle provides seamless flush mounting in precision-machined surfaces, while the partial threading design concentrates strength where needed most. Manufactured to ASTM F835 specifications, these screws maintain dimensional stability in high-stress industrial environments, making them ideal for automotive, construction, and manufacturing applications requiring reliable inch system fasteners.
Specification Summary & Compliance
This 1/2"-20 UNF flat head screw features precision Class 3A thread fit per Unified Thread Standard with 6 1/2" length and partial threading (minimum 1 3/4" thread length). Manufacturing complies with ASTM F835 specifications for alloy steel fasteners, with full compliance to RoHS 3 (2015/863/EU) and REACH (EC 1907/2006) environmental regulations. The inch system measurement ensures compatibility with North American industrial standards and equipment specifications.
